I discovered Hot Wok a few years ago and make it a point to eat there whenever I'm in Donaldsonville. The restaurant doesn’t have a buffet; it’s one of those places where you order and then they cook your food. The menu is extensive, offering plenty of choices. They have a lunch special that runs from 10:30 AM to 3:00 PM. Recently, they’ve also started allowing dine-in, not just takeout. The food is excellent, and since it’s cooked after you order, it’s always hot. There may be a short wait, but it's definitely worth it. The portions are generous—I'm quite a big eater, yet I often can't finish my meal. The egg rolls are decent, but nothing extraordinary. I have witnessed the owner being rude to some customers, though she has always been nice to me. Ultimately, if you're looking for good Chinese cuisine in the area, I would highly recommend giving Hot Wok a try. The food is definitely worth it!
